Ducommun Incorporated Acquires Nobles Worldwide 

Global Leader in the Design and Manufacturing of High Performance Ammunition Handling Systems for Military Air, Sea and Ground Platforms


SANTA ANA, Calif., Oct. 09, 2019 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Ducommun Incorporated (NYSE:DCO) (“Ducommun” or the “Company”) today announced that it has completed the acquisition of Nobles Worldwide Inc. (“Nobles”) based in St. Croix Falls, Wisconsin.

Founded in 1948, Nobles Worldwide is the global leader in the design and manufacture of high performance ammunition handling systems for military aircraft, helicopters, ground vehicles and shipboard systems. Nobles is currently the primary ammunition feed chute supplier to most F-Series aircraft and naval close-in weapon systems in the U.S. and supports more than 50 different such systems in 50 other countries worldwide. In addition to its full-sized, customized solutions, Nobles offers a range of systems for small and medium caliber weapon stations and medium caliber turrets.

Ducommun financed the purchase through its existing revolving credit facility.

About Ducommun Incorporated
Ducommun Incorporated delivers value-added innovative manufacturing solutions to customers in the aerospace, defense and industrial markets. Founded in 1849, the Company specializes in two core areas - Electronic Systems and Structural Systems - to produce complex products and components for commercial aircraft platforms, mission-critical military and space programs, and sophisticated industrial applications. About Nobles Worldwide
Founded in 1948, Nobles Worldwide is the largest supplier of ammunition feed systems to all branches of the U.S. military and its allies. Nobles is recognized globally for its superior durability products, cutting-edge designs and rigorous quality assurance. Nobles Worldwide offers lighter, stronger and more flexible materials used in ammunition chutes, magazines, gun mounts and weapon stations. Nobles is based in St. Croix Falls, Wisconsin.
